Controlled Substance (Drug) Schedules & Penalties in Florida

By T.S. Lupella

Understanding Florida’s Drug Schedules and Penalties Florida law categorizes controlled substances into five schedules, based on their potential for abuse and accepted medical use. The higher the schedule, the more serious the offense for illegal possession, distribution, or trafficking. Constructive Possession Drug Defense In Florida

By T.S. Lupella

Black’s Law Dictionary defines constructive possession as “[c]ontrol or dominion over a property without actual possession or custody of it.” If a person is arrested for possession of drugs, they are alleged to have constructively possessed narcotics, a different set of elements must be proven to … [Read more...] about Constructive Possession Drug Defense In Florida
